1:13:16Now PlayingPaul Ollinger is a comedian, former Facebook executive, and podcast host. Paul shares stories from his early life and unpacks his journey from corporate tech to stand-up comedy. He also reflects on his time at Facebook, its evolution, and the effects of social media on society. The discussion delves into political polarisation, media bias, and the future of American politics.
